We can all get an extra hour of rest tonight as clocks turn back for winter time... but it could possibly be one of the last switchovers.

The clocks will be going backward on Sunday at 2am. While your smartphone and laptops will update automatically, analog clocks and other digital clocks, like car and oven clocks, will need to be changed manually.

The clocks go forward again on Sunday, March 31 next year.

But this unpopular practice could soon be destined to history.

The European Commission said it would allowing each member state to decide by April whether they prefer permanently having the standard time or daylight savings time.

This follows an EU survey where 80 per cent of Europeans said they were opposed to the clock changes.
